Frequently asked questions about emergency babysitters in San Francisco

How do I find an emergency babysitter in San Francisco?

Sign up for an UrbanSitter account, then share the date, time, and number of children who need care. Available sitters in San Francisco can respond, and you can review full profiles before booking.

How much does an emergency babysitter cost in San Francisco?

Babysitting rates in San Francisco vary by experience, number of children, and job length. For same-day care, offering a higher rate can help attract interest and a faster response. See average babysitting rates in your area.

Are babysitters in San Francisco on UrbanSitter background checked?

Yes. Every babysitter on UrbanSitter completes an annual background check, including those in San Francisco, and each profile is individually reviewed by our Trust and Safety team. See what's included in the background check.
